What is Dominium (DOM)?

Dominium (DOM) is a cryptocurrency project distinguished by its backing with real-world assets. Instead of being purely speculative or relying solely on technological innovation, Dominium aims to create a stable and revenue-generating ecosystem. This ecosystem is anchored by a basket of assets that includes commercial units, Airbnb properties, gold, mining operations, and stakes in various companies. The fundamental philosophy behind Dominium is that real ownership of tangible assets – land, real estate, and commodities – holds enduring value and power, transcending the fluctuations and potential instability of traditional currencies.

The core objective of Dominium is to build a treasury that is not only resistant to inflation and currency volatility but also capable of generating substantial revenue streams over the long term. This revenue is intended to be distributed to token holders and used to further enhance the Dominium ecosystem. Specifically, a key mechanism involves using the generated revenue to buy back and burn DOM tokens, creating a deflationary effect that could potentially increase the value of the remaining tokens. Moreover, Dominium offers a staking program called “School of Thought” that allows participants to earn passive income derived from the real-world assets backing the cryptocurrency.

Dominium also integrates with N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ens), allowing access to Dominium’s physical properties. Holding specific NFTs gives holders access to housing or real estate development opportunities. The project aims to bridge the gap between the on-chain and off-chain worlds, offering tangible benefits and real-world utility to its token holders. The project seeks to go beyond the traditional use cases of cryptocurrencies by combining digital assets with real-world ownership.

How Does Dominium (DOM) Work?

Dominium’s operational mechanism revolves around its asset-backed structure and its commitment to generating revenue through those assets. The process begins with the acquisition of a diverse portfolio of real-world assets, ranging from commercial real estate to gold and mining ventures. These assets form the basis of Dominium’s intrinsic value and serve as a hedge against the volatility often associated with purely digital currencies.

The revenue generated by these assets is crucial to Dominium’s model. A portion of this revenue is allocated to buy back and burn DOM tokens from the open market. This “burn” process permanently removes tokens from circulation, reducing the overall supply. The result is a deflationary effect, meaning that the remaining tokens become increasingly scarce over time. This scarcity, coupled with the ongoing revenue generation, has the potential to increase the value of each DOM token.

The “School of Thought” staking program is another important component. By staking their DOM tokens, participants gain access to a share of the passive income generated by Dominium’s asset portfolio. This provides a direct incentive to hold DOM tokens and participate in the ecosystem. The program encourages long-term investment and helps to stabilize the token’s price by reducing its volatility. The NFT integration adds another layer of functionality, tying token ownership to real-world benefits and access. The smart contracts manage the buying and burning of DOM tokens, and also the distribution of revenue generated to stakers.

How Do You Store Dominium (DOM)?

Storing Dominium (DOM) requires a compatible cryptocurrency wallet that supports the token’s underlying blockchain. The type of wallet you choose will depend on your security preferences and how frequently you plan to access your DOM tokens. The most secure option is typically a hardware wallet, which stores your private keys offline, making them resistant to hacking attempts. Popular hardware wallets include Ledger and Trezor. These wallets can be connected to your computer when you need to make transactions, but otherwise remain offline.

Software wallets, also known as hot wallets, are another option. These wallets are installed on your computer or smartphone and offer convenient access to your DOM tokens. However, they are generally less secure than hardware wallets because your private keys are stored online. Examples of software wallets include desktop wallets, mobile wallets, and browser extensions. When choosing a software wallet, make sure to download it from the official source and enable two-factor authentication for added security.

Exchange wallets are also an option for storing DOM, but this is generally not recommended for long-term storage. Exchange wallets are custodial, meaning that the exchange controls your private keys. If the exchange is hacked or goes out of business, you could lose your funds. It’s best to only keep a small amount of DOM on an exchange for trading purposes. Regardless of the type of wallet you choose, it’s crucial to back up your private keys or seed phrase in a secure location. This will allow you to recover your DOM tokens if your wallet is lost or damaged. Consider using a multi-signature wallet, which requires multiple approvals to authorize transactions.
